> > This patch implements acpi_os_readable(). The function is used by
> > ACPICA AML debugger to validate user specified pointers for dumping
> > the memory as ACPICA descriptor objects.

> What does "readable" mean in this context?
'readable' means : the address provided by the user,
is a dynamically allocated virtual address -
because the acpi address space are allocated by 'kmalloc',
acpi debugger must check if this address is a valid 'kmalloc'
address before accessing it.
This function does the sanity check that, the vitual address is a:
1. dynamically allocated address (beyond PAGE_OFFSET , but lower
than high_memory, VMALLOC_START, eg)
2. besides, the physical address must be direct-mapped(so it would not be a
hole).
